Do you pay for preschool in Australia?

In Australia, every child is entitled to free or subsidised preschool for 15 hours a week (or 600 hours in a year).

What is the difference between preschool and kindergarten in Australia?

In Australia pre-school is the year before children attend kindergarten at a primary school. Remember, Australia’s kindergarten is New Zealand’s year 1. See my Australian schools post. Some pre-schools only accept children that are eligible to start kindergarten the following year.

Is childcare free in France?

Childcare costs in France The good news is that school is free for all children from the age of 3 in France. Before that, most children are looked after by a nounou (a professional childminder) or in a crèche (nursery).

How much does kindergarten cost in Australia?

Average Cost of Childcare in Australia

Hourly Rate Cap Average Rate Per Hour
Outside School Hours Care $10.29 $7.50
Family Day Care and In-Home Daycare $10.90 $8.95
Centre-Based Day Care $11.77 $9.60
Kindergarten and Preschool The recommended 15 hours are free Free

Which country has the best preschool education?

The Nordic countries perform best at preschool, and European countries dominate the rankings. Finland, Sweden and Norway top the Index, thanks to sustained, long-term investments and prioritisation of early childhood development, which is now deeply embedded in society.
